My sister found a recipe for Black Bean and Corn Salsa, which is the main ingredient in the Chopped Leaf Southwest Salad (my personal favourite), having this recipe pretty much makes my summer! Just add lettuce (or spinach) and grilled chicken and tada a Southwest copy cat salad!
1 cup corn
1 cup black beans
1 cup red bell pepper
Purple onion to taste
1 cup ranch dressing
2 tbsp taco seasoning (I added more seasoning to my desired taste)

Cucumber Tomato Salad
2 diced tomatoes
2 cucumbers (diced)
1 cup green peppers (diced, any colour of pepper works)
1 cup onion (diced)
2 tbsp sugar substitute (I used agave nectar)
Make it Greek....
Just add Feta Cheese and Krafts Greek salad dressing!
